Olle Persson's "Svenska Romanser, Vol. 2" is a captivating collection of Swedish ballads and choral works, released on May 1, 2011, under the Phono Suecia label. This album is a testament to Olle Persson's versatility and deep connection with Swedish musical heritage. Spanning a duration of 1 hour and 13 minutes, the album features a diverse range of compositions, from traditional Swedish songs to contemporary choral pieces.
The tracklist is a rich tapestry of musical styles and themes, beginning with 13 Gammalsvenska Wijsor (Old Swedish Songs) that offer a glimpse into Sweden's musical past. The album then transitions into works inspired by the poetry of Bo Bergman, showcasing Olle Persson's ability to bring poetic words to life through music. The inclusion of songs from "Facklor i stormen" (Torches in the Storm) and "Den utvalda" (The Chosen One) adds a dramatic and narrative element to the collection.
Olle Persson's interpretation of "Chansons de Bilitis" by Pierre Louÿs brings a touch of French elegance and sensuality to the album, demonstrating the artist's range and adaptability. The album also features compositions from "Dikter, Op. 17" and "I skogen om natten" (In the Forest at Night), which are particularly evocative and atmospheric, highlighting Olle Persson's skill in creating immersive musical landscapes.
"Svenska Romanser, Vol. 2" is not just a collection of songs but a journey through the rich tapestry of Swedish music, blending tradition with contemporary influences. Olle Persson's nuanced performances and the album's diverse repertoire make it a compelling listen for anyone interested in the depth and beauty of Swedish musical expression.
